Have you ever wondered why things are bought and sold? In Heaven there is no such thing. Everything is Grace. Grace means Gift. All giving and all receiving of gifts is grace. And this exchange is wholly free - there is no cost; the price has already been paid. Of what phenomenon does this transpire? The cause and effect is God who is only Grace. Every creation of God is nothing but an expression of God in truth. Therefore, every creation of God is a Gift, only! When we are true to ourselves, then we are true to all. Then we are as we were created - in the image and likeness of God ... who is the Gift. And You and I are Gifts to each other and all!
Certainly truth is heaven, uncorrupted by the lie of sin which is rooted only in selfishness. This is the complete and total opposite of God who is unselfishness personified. Naturally, unselfishness can not reproduce selfishness ... and vice-versa, anymore than godliness can create ungodliness. Good makes good, not bad. A Good God DID NOT, WOULD NOT, and furthermore COULD NOT create sin, evil, satan. God Can Not Deny Himself ... if it were possible he would cease to be God, plain and simple!
Freely we have received, freely we give - and grace for grace!
A gift can only truly be given. Anything else and it is no longer a gift. And for that matter, the receiving of any gift is a gift - the grace to welcome a place, a home, an appreciative heart for the gift that is offered. One is not without the other.
